How Currency Affects Coupon Discounts
The value of coupon discounts is indeed influenced by the currency selected. Let’s explore how this happens:
1. Currency Conversion and Its Impact
When you apply a coupon, the discount is often calculated based on the currency associated with the price of the item. Here’s how:
- If you are shopping in USD and using a coupon worth $10, the value of this coupon remains fixed in USD.
- However, if you switch to EUR, and the exchange rate indicates that $10 equals €9, your coupon’s value effectively decreases.
The process of currency conversion is vital in determining how much you save when using a coupon. Therefore, it’s essential to check the current exchange rates if you’re utilizing discounts in a different currency.
2. Coupon Terms and Conditions
Every coupon has terms and conditions that may specify its validity in certain currencies. Understanding these rules can help clarify:
- Valid Currencies: Some coupons may only be valid in specific currencies.
- Exclusions: There could be exclusions for certain regions or currencies.
Before applying a coupon, carefully read its terms to ensure you understand how it applies to your selected currency.

FAQ
1. Do coupon discounts convert with the currency rate?
Yes, coupon discounts may be affected by the currency conversion rate. If a discount is calculated in a different currency, the value can change based on current exchange rates.
2. Are discounts in local currency better than in foreign currency?
Often, discounts applied in your local currency can be more advantageous because they reflect the local pricing strategy, making them more straightforward for budgeting.
3. Can I still use a coupon if I switch currency?
In most cases, yes. However, the discount amount may vary when you switch currencies due to conversion rates and retailer policies.
4. What should I do if my coupon is invalid in my currency?
If a coupon is marked invalid in your selected currency, try contacting customer support to see if they can provide assistance or an alternative discount.
5. How can I find the best currency to use for discounts?
To find the best currency, consider using currency conversion tools and compare prices across different currencies before finalizing a purchase.
